					<description><![CDATA[Peter Zlotnick is the Principal Timpanist for the Greensboro Symphony and the Winston-Salem Symphony. He is also Principal Timpanist for the Salisbury Symphony and substitutes on timpani with the North Carolina Symphony and the Charlotte Symphony. 					<description><![CDATA[Anna Dagmar is a NYC-based pianist, singer-songwriter and composer. Dagmar made her Broadway debut in 2017 as a sub Pianist and Conductor for Sara Bareilles’ musical Waitress.
